问题列表 - 第5589页

JavaScript等效于printf/String.Format

我正在寻找一个很好的JavaScript等价的C/PHP printf()或C#/ Java程序员String.Format()(IFormatProvider对于.NET).

我的基本要求是现在有一千个数字分隔符格式,但处理许多组合(包括日期)的东西会很好.

我意识到Microsoft的Ajax库提供了一个版本String.Format(),但我们不希望该框架的整个开销.

javascript string.format printf

1874
推荐指数
30
解决办法
160万
查看次数

VS2008中的自动装配版本号管理

我有一个用c#编写的VS2008项目,其中包含许多程序集.我想有一个简单的方法来管理所有不同程序集之间的版本号,以及一种自动增加构建号的方法,并将其保存到每个程序集的版本号中.

我猜这是大多数项目的问题,所以大概以前它已经解决了?

关于如何简化项目版本资源管理的任何建议?

assemblies visual-studio-2008

13
推荐指数
2
解决办法
6701
查看次数

为什么不通过实例调用静态方法为Java编译器的错误?

我相信你们都知道我的意思 - 代码如下:

Thread thread = new Thread();
int activeCount = thread.activeCount();
Run Code Online (Sandbox Code Playgroud)

引发编译器警告.为什么不是错误?

编辑:

要明确:问题与Threads无关.我意识到在讨论这个问题时经常给出Thread示例,因为它们可能真的搞砸了它们.但问题确实是这样的使用总是无稽之谈,你不能(胜任地)写出这样的电话并且意味着它.这种类型的方法调用的任何例子都是barmy.这是另一个:

String hello = "hello";
String number123AsString = hello.valueOf(123);
Run Code Online (Sandbox Code Playgroud)

这使得它看起来好像每个String实例都带有"String valueOf(int i)"方法.

java methods static

75
推荐指数
4
解决办法
3万
查看次数

在多边形内找到轴对齐的矩形

我正在寻找一个好的算法来找到一个(不一定是凸面)多边形内的轴对齐矩形.最大的矩形会很好,但不是必需的 - 任何可以找到"相当好"的矩形的算法都可以.

多边形也可能有孔,但任何只适用于凸多边形或简单多边形的算法指针也会有所帮助.

在我的实现中,对于边的交叉测试相当便宜,但是"多边形点"测试是昂贵的,因此理想情况下应该最小化.

algorithm geometry polygon rectangles

16
推荐指数
2
解决办法
8357
查看次数

查找并替换HTML标记

我有以下HTML:

<html>
<body>
<h1>Foo</h1>
<p>The quick brown fox.</p>
<h1>Bar</h1>
<p>Jumps over the lazy dog.</p>
</body>
</html>
Run Code Online (Sandbox Code Playgroud)

我想将其更改为以下HTML:

<html>
<body>
<p class="title">Foo</p>
<p>The quick brown fox.</p>
<p class="title">Bar</p>
<p>Jumps over the lazy dog.</p>
</body>
</html>
Run Code Online (Sandbox Code Playgroud)

如何查找和替换某些HTML标记?我可以使用Nokogiri宝石.

html ruby string parsing nokogiri

14
推荐指数
3
解决办法
1万
查看次数

将结果绑定到php数组中

我正在尝试以下代码从查询中获取结果并将其显示在tes.php页面中.

db.inc.php

<?php
function db_connect()
{
    $handle=new mysqli('localhost','rekandoa','rekandoa','rekandoa');
 if (!$handle)
{
       return false;
   }
return $handle;
}

function get_member()
{
    $handle=db_connect();
$sql="Select email,nama,alamat,kota,propinsi from users where email=?";
    $stmt=$handle->prepare($sql);
  $mail='yonghan79@gmail.com';
    $stmt->bind_param("s",$mail); 
 $stmt->execute();
  $stmt->bind_result($email,$nama,$alamat,$kota,$propinsi);
  $result=$stmt->fetch();
    return $result;
}
?>
Run Code Online (Sandbox Code Playgroud)

tes.php

<?php
error_reporting(E_ALL & ~E_NOTICE);
include('db.inc.php');
$w=get_member();
echo $w['member_id'];
echo '<br>';
echo $w['email'];
echo '<br>';
echo $w['status'];
echo '<br>';
?>
Run Code Online (Sandbox Code Playgroud)

我没有收到错误消息,但结果没有显示,只是一个空白页面.

我做错了什么?

php mysql mysqli prepared-statement

2
推荐指数
1
解决办法
3723
查看次数

在哪里下载酷动画进行测试?

我正在寻找一些网站,我可以下载一些短片(5-20​​秒)用于视频导入例程的测试目的.

有没有人有wmv,mpeg,mov等的数据源?

谢谢!

testing animation

5
推荐指数
1
解决办法
1769
查看次数

我应该使用什么图像类型?GIF,JPG还是PNG?

我正在尝试为自己创建一个个人主页,以了解有关网页设计(JavaScript,使用Photo Shop等)的更多信息.我打算在左边有一个图形菜单,在顶部有一个横幅,还有一个"照片"部分,在那里我可以显示我拍摄的各种照片的照片.

但是,当我查看其他类似的网站时,我看到一些使用GIF,有些使用JPG,有些甚至使用PNG.这些之间有什么区别吗?我应该使用GIF用于网站上使用的图形图像和JPG用于我的照片吗?我应该制作一切PNG吗?


完全重复:

html image

8
推荐指数
4
解决办法
1万
查看次数

可自定义的sprintf()实现

任何人都可以指向我的源代码文件或在C中具有良好,可重用的sprintf()实现的包,我可以根据自己的需要自定义?

解释为什么我需要它:字符串不是在我的代码中终止(二进制兼容).因此,除非我修复代码以了解如何呈现字符串,否则sprintf("%s")是无用的.

感谢quinmars指出有办法通过%s打印字符串,而不会终止它.虽然它现在解决了这个问题,但我最终还是需要使用sprintf(或snprintf)实现更高级别的函数来使用变体.到目前为止,在我看来,SQLite实现是最好的.感谢Doug Currie指出它.

c printf

3
推荐指数
1
解决办法
2万
查看次数

在Global.asax上使用IHttpModule

我被赋予了重写我们的异常处理系统的惊险任务.虽然我会说从应用程序范围来看处理异常并不是我们想要的,但是当我们的团队因为我们需要推出门的大量工作而人手不足时通常是不可避免的,所以请不要燃烧这里异常处理的全球化解决方案:)

我有一个很好的追捕,看看有什么常见的解决方案.目前,我们将Global.asax与Application_Error事件一起使用以执行处于会话状态的Server.GetLastError(),然后将重定向调用到另一个页面,然后检索会话数据并以人类可读的格式输出.重定向还调用一个sproc,它将仔细审核错误信息,a)通过电子邮件发送给开发人员,b)从只能由开发人员查看的网页查看.

我看到做事的新方法是使用IHttpModule接口使用App_Code中的类来做这些事情(这是我的快速实现)

Imports Microsoft.VisualBasic

Public Class ErrorModule : Implements IHttpModule

  Public Sub Dispose() Implements System.Web.IHttpModule.Dispose
    ' Not used
  End Sub

  Public Sub Init(ByVal context As System.Web.HttpApplication) Implements System.Web.IHttpModule.Init
    AddHandler context.Error, AddressOf context_Error
  End Sub

  Public Sub context_Error(ByVal sender As Object, ByVal e As EventArgs)
    Dim ex As Exception = HttpContext.Current.Server.GetLastError

    ' do something with the error
    ' call the stored procedure
    ' redirect the user to the error page

    HttpContext.Current.Server.ClearError()
    HttpContext.Current.Response.Redirect("index.htm")

  End Sub
End Class
Run Code Online (Sandbox Code Playgroud)

我的问题是,这个解决方案比使用Global.asax事件有什么好处?此外,将数据传递到错误页面的最佳方法是什么?

编辑:上面的代码确实工作;)

编辑: …

vb.net asp.net ihttpmodule global-asax

4
推荐指数
1
解决办法
5148
查看次数